Essential Tips for Foreigners Considering Plastic Surgery in South Korea 

 

 

Plastic surgery in South Korea continues to be one of the most sought-after destinations for international patients in 2025. Renowned for its innovative procedures, world-class surgeons, and remarkable results, South Korea has earned its title as the global leader in cosmetic surgery. However, there are critical factors that international patients need to understand before undergoing surgery. From understanding Korean beauty standards to managing post-surgery recovery, here are key tips to help you navigate the plastic surgery process in South Korea.

 

 

 

1. Understanding the "Korean Beauty Standard" and Its Impact on Results

While many are aware of Korean beauty standards, few understand how deeply it impacts the procedures and final results. South Korean cosmetic surgery emphasizes a soft, youthful appearance—think delicate jawlines, larger eyes, a more refined nose, and subtle, natural-looking enhancements.

Pro Tip: If you’re not of East Asian descent, discuss your desired results in detail with your surgeon. Make sure your surgeon understands your aesthetic preferences to achieve the best outcome, as Korean surgeons focus on facial harmony and balance.

2. How to Choose the Right Clinic Beyond Google Reviews

When choosing a plastic surgery clinic in Korea, many patients rely on online reviews and Instagram influencers. However, these may not always represent the best clinics or surgeons. To make a well-informed decision:

  • Check the clinic’s global accreditation from organizations like the International Joint Commission.

  • Ask for references from international patients who underwent similar procedures.

 

Pro Tip: It’s harder to fake solid references from real patients than it is to pay for online influencers. Look for patient testimonials that match your background and expectations.

 

 

 

3. Digital Technology Integration: Virtual Try-Ons and AI Planning

The integration of AI and 3D imaging technologies is revolutionizing the plastic surgery industry in Korea. Clinics like AB Plastic Surgery Korea use advanced 3D modeling software to simulate post-surgery results, ensuring you visualize your transformation before committing.

Pro Tip: Look for clinics that offer virtual consultations or AI-assisted simulations, so you can see the expected results and adjust your choices as needed.

4. Navigating Language Barriers and International Patient Support

While many clinics in Korea offer English-speaking surgeons, language barriers can still present challenges, especially with post-operative care. Ensure that the clinic provides dedicated international patient managers who can help with communication, as well as in-house interpreters for follow-up care.

Pro Tip: Use hospitals that cater specifically to international patients and offer multilingual support to avoid misunderstandings during your recovery.

 

 

 

5. What’s Often Left Out: Complications and Scarring

Every surgery comes with its risks, and cosmetic surgery complications are often glossed over in reviews. Even the best surgeons can’t guarantee perfect results, and scarring may occur despite skillful techniques.

Pro Tip: Ask your clinic about their revision policy and whether they offer scar-healing treatments like laser therapy. Make sure you understand the risk of scarring and how to manage it.

6. Pre-Surgery Prep: More Than Just Avoiding Alcohol

A proper pre-surgery preparation goes beyond avoiding alcohol and smoking. Your diet and supplements play a significant role in both the success of the surgery and your recovery process.

Pro Tip: Incorporate anti-inflammatory foods like turmeric, ginger, and omega-3-rich items into your diet in the weeks leading up to surgery. Consult your surgeon about taking supplements like Vitamin C, Zinc, and Arnica to support faster tissue healing.

 

 

 

7. Mental Health Check Before and After Surgery

Cosmetic surgery can have a profound impact on self-esteem, and the emotional effects can sometimes outweigh the physical recovery. Many patients experience anxiety or depression after their procedures, even if the physical results are successful.

Pro Tip: Consult a therapist before surgery to help navigate emotional changes. After surgery, allow time for adjustment and manage expectations for your appearance.

 

 

 

8. Recovery Locations: Staying Close to the Hospital for Peace of Mind

Seoul is the hub for plastic surgery in Korea, but many international patients overlook the stress that busy urban areas can cause during recovery. Crowded streets, noise, and pollution can hinder the healing process.

Pro Tip: It’s advisable to stay near the hospital during your recovery, so you can quickly visit in case you experience any complications or need post-operative care. Many clinics, including AB Plastic Surgery Korea, offer recovery accommodations nearby, allowing for easy access to follow-up appointments and medical support. This ensures peace of mind and a smoother recovery process, without the added stress of long commutes or navigating unfamiliar areas.

 

 

 

9. Timing Your Surgery: Avoiding Holidays and Peak Seasons

South Korea’s plastic surgery clinics can become very busy during holidays like Chuseok or Lunar New Year. If you want personalized care and faster recovery times, avoid booking during these peak periods.

Pro Tip: Plan your surgery during early spring or fall, when the weather is ideal, and the clinics are less crowded. This ensures a more comfortable recovery experience.

10. Post-Surgery Travel: Consider an Extended Stay for Recovery

Rushing back home after surgery can impede your recovery. Staying in Korea for a few weeks post-surgery allows you to access follow-up care and any necessary adjustments.
